Title: 1969 Eliminator spare tire
Post by: c9zx on August 08, 2020, 01:57:34 PM
Did any 1969 Cougar Eliminators come with a space saver spare? Thanks, Chuck

Post by: 70b302cat on August 09, 2020, 12:49:40 PM
Chuck,

We know of several 1970 Elminators that were equipped with "space saver spare tires", however, we presently do not know of any 1969 Eliminators so equipped.

Post by: Bob Gaines on August 09, 2020, 02:49:33 PM
Thanks for the replies gentlemen. I was just curious. The original spare tire decal is still intact and show a full size spare. The decal number is C9ZB-17093-C. The car's build date is June 12, 1969. Thanks, Chuck
The 14 inch wheels allowed a full size spare to fit easily in the trunk which is why so few examples have space savers. Boss 302,429 ,69/70 Shelby all came with 15 inch wheels which required the space saver because the 15 inch wheel would not fit easily if at all especially with the wide tread tires.
